#CCC4F7 Color
#CCC4F7 is rgb(204, 196, 247) in RGB, hsl(249, 76%, 87%) in HSL, and about cmyk(17%, 21%, 0%, 3%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Lavender Blue (#CCCCFF),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.61.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#CCC4F7 Channel Values
How #CCC4F7 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 204 · G 196 · B 247 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 249° · S 76% · L 87%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 249° · S 21% · V 97%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 17% · M 21% · Y 0% · K 3%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.64:1 vs white · 12.81: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#CCC4F7 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#CCC4F7 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#CCC4F7?
#CCC4F7 is a lightest blue — rgb(204, 196, 247) in RGB and hsl(249, 76%, 87%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Lavender Blue (#CCCCFF),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.61.
What is the RGB value of #CCC4F7?
#CCC4F7 is rgb(204, 196, 247) — red 204, green 196, and blue 247 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#CCC4F7?
#CCC4F7 converts to approximately cmyk(17%, 21%, 0%, 3%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#CCC4F7 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#CCC4F7 scores 1.64:1 against white and 12.81: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#CCC4F7 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#CCC4F7 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is thistle (#D8BFD8) at a CIE76 distance of 15.28, which is visibly different.
